Lo mato
by Willie Colón & Héctor Lavoe
'Lo mato' showcases the creative zenith of the Willie Colón and Héctor Lavoe partnership, crystallizing their raw, trombone-heavy "salsa dura" sound. The album is defined by Colón's aggressive arrangements and a rugged production that frames Lavoe's mature and soulful vocals, which expertly convey stories of street-level danger and fatalism. Landmark tracks like the cautionary narrative "Calle Luna, Calle Sol" and the philosophical "Todo Tiene Su Final" blend sophisticated musicality with dark, realistic themes, cementing the record as a cornerstone of 1970s salsa.
